Why two students studying the same content may need different approaches
Conceptual Learner
Needs the "why" before the "how"
- Prefers understanding principles first
- Transfers knowledge to new problems easily
- May resist rote practice without context
Procedural Learner
Needs the "how" to understand the "why"
- Prefers step-by-step examples first
- Builds understanding through practice
- May feel lost with abstract explanations
Same topic. Same goal. Different pathways to understanding. MindPrint ensures the right approach is used from the start.

Same Curriculum, Adapted Delivery
How MindPrint shapes every session
The textbooks remain consistent. The tutor's delivery method adapts.
Fixed Curriculum
Textbooks
NSW Syllabus
Same for all students
Tutor Informed by MindPrint
Tutor
Guided by profile
Delivery Method Adapts
Conceptual
From Textbook
Solve: 2x + 5 = 13
Tutor explains: Why it works
"Think of an equation like a balanced scale. Whatever is on the left side must equal what's on the right. If we have 2x + 5 on one side and 13 on the other, they're perfectly balanced. To find x, we need to isolate it while keeping both sides equal. Subtract 5 from both sides—the scale stays balanced. Now we have 2x = 8. Divide both sides by 2, and we discover x = 4. The balance never tips because we do the same thing to both sides."
Procedural
From Textbook
Solve: 2x + 5 = 13
Tutor explains: How to do it
Start: 2x + 5 = 13
Subtract 5: 2x = 8
Divide by 2: x = 4
